Shively Animal Clinic & Hospital PSC is dedicated to providing exceptional veterinary care to cats, dogs, exotic pets, birds, and pocket pets throughout Kentucky and Indiana. Our clinic offers a wide range of services to ensure the health and well-being of your pets at every stage of life. These include thorough health examinations, preventive care such as vaccinations, dental services, and comprehensive laboratory diagnostics. We specialize in both soft-tissue and orthopedic surgeries, providing advanced surgical care for a variety of conditions. Additionally, our team offers personalized nutritional counseling to help maintain your pet’s health and well-being through appropriate diet plans.

Our comment from InfoVet about Shively Animal Clinic & Hospital:

Shively Animal Clinic & Hospital is a well-respected veterinary facility in Louisville, known for its compassionate care and dedication to pets. Customers frequently highlight the knowledgeable staff and their genuine concern for animals. Many clients have shared positive experiences, stating that the clinic goes above and beyond in ensuring the well-being of their pets, even during difficult times, such as end-of-life decisions. The affordability of services is also a strong point, making it accessible to a wide range of pet owners.

However, some clients have expressed frustrations regarding long wait times, particularly because the clinic operates without set appointments, leading to extended stays for routine visits. Additionally, there have been concerns about communication issues and staff professionalism in certain situations. Despite these challenges, many long-time patrons appreciate the quality of care their pets receive.
